Method
Prepare the Churro Dough
- 1
Combine wet ingredients
In a medium saucepan, combine the water, unsalted butter, granulated sugar, and salt. Bring the mixture to a boil over medium heat.
- 2
Mix in flour
Once boiling, remove from heat and add the all-purpose flour. Stir vigorously with a wooden spoon until the dough forms a ball and pulls away from the sides of the pan.
- 3
Add eggs
Let the dough cool for about 5 minutes. Then, add the eggs one at a time, stirring well after each addition until fully incorporated and the dough is smooth.
Prepare the Cinnamon Sugar Coating
- 4
Mix cinnamon and sugar
In a shallow dish, combine the granulated sugar and ground cinnamon. Stir until well mixed and set aside.
Fry the Churros
- 5
- 6
Pipe the dough
Transfer the churro dough into a piping bag fitted with a large star tip. Carefully pipe 4-6 inch long strips of dough directly into the hot oil.
- 7
Fry until golden
Fry the churros for about 2-3 minutes on each side, or until they are golden brown. Use a slotted spoon to remove them from the oil and drain on paper towels.
